1993 Audi V8 vs. 2006 Cadillac DTS

To start off, 2006 Cadillac DTS is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Audi V8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Audi V8 would be higher. At 4,572 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Cadillac DTS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Cadillac DTS (275 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 28 more horse power than 1993 Audi V8. (247 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Cadillac DTS should accelerate faster than 1993 Audi V8.

Because 1993 Audi V8 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Cadillac DTS.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1993 Audi V8 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Cadillac DTS (396 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 56 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Audi V8. (340 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2006 Cadillac DTS will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Audi V8.
